Cómo mostrar tu dirección IP usando JavaScript: Guía paso a paso

¿Te gustaría aprender cómo mostrar tu dirección IP utilizando JavaScript? En esta guía paso a paso, descubrirás cómo obtener y mostrar tu dirección IP de una manera sencilla y rápida. Ya sea que estés desarrollando una aplicación web, realizando análisis de seguridad o simplemente quieras conocer tu dirección IP, este tutorial te brindará todo lo que necesitas saber. ¡No pierdas más tiempo y comencemos a explorar el fascinante mundo de las direcciones IP!

Si eres un programador o estás interesado en el mundo de la programación, es probable que hayas oído hablar de JavaScript. Esta poderosa herramienta de programación se utiliza ampliamente en el desarrollo web para agregar interactividad a los sitios y aplicaciones. Una de las funcionalidades interesantes que puedes implementar con JavaScript es mostrar la dirección IP del usuario.

En este artículo, aprenderás qué es una dirección IP, por qué es útil mostrarla con JavaScript y cómo hacerlo paso a paso. También responderemos algunas preguntas frecuentes relacionadas con este tema.

Índice
  1. ¿Qué es una dirección IP?
  2. ¿Por qué mostrar la dirección IP con JavaScript?
  3. Cómo mostrar la dirección IP utilizando JavaScript
  4. Conclusión
  5. Preguntas frecuentes

¿Qué es una dirección IP?

Una dirección IP, o Protocolo de Internet, es una etiqueta numérica única asignada a cada dispositivo conectado a una red. Esta etiqueta permite la identificación y comunicación entre diferentes dispositivos en una red, ya sea una red local o la red global de Internet.

¿Por qué mostrar la dirección IP con JavaScript?

Mostrar la dirección IP del usuario puede ser útil en diferentes situaciones. Por ejemplo, puedes utilizarla para personalizar la experiencia del usuario, como mostrar información localizada o adaptar el contenido según la ubicación geográfica del usuario. También puede ser útil para rastrear y analizar el tráfico en tu sitio web o aplicación.

Cómo mostrar la dirección IP utilizando JavaScript

Mostrar la dirección IP con JavaScript es bastante sencillo. Puedes utilizar diferentes métodos y librerías para obtener la dirección IP del cliente. A continuación, te mostraré un ejemplo utilizando el método más común utilizando la API Geolocation de HTML5:


if ("geolocation" in navigator) {
navigator.geolocation.getCurrentPosition(function(position) {
const ip = position.coords.latitude + ", " + position.coords.longitude;
document.getElementById("ip-address").innerHTML = ip;
});
} else {
document.getElementById("ip-address").innerHTML = "La geolocalización no está disponible en tu navegador.";
}

En este ejemplo, utilizamos el método getCurrentPosition de la API Geolocation para obtener la posición actual del usuario. A partir de esta posición, podemos extraer las coordenadas de latitud y longitud, que se pueden utilizar como una representación básica de la dirección IP. Luego, simplemente actualizamos el contenido del elemento HTML con el id "ip-address" con la dirección IP obtenida.

Conclusión

Mostrar la dirección IP con JavaScript puede ser útil en muchas situaciones, ya sea para personalizar la experiencia del usuario o analizar el tráfico en tu sitio web. Con la API Geolocation de HTML5 y un poco de JavaScript, puedes obtener la dirección IP del usuario de manera sencilla.

Preguntas frecuentes

1. ¿Qué es JavaScript?

JavaScript es un lenguaje de programación de alto nivel y de propósito general que se utiliza principalmente en el desarrollo web. Permite agregar interactividad y dinamismo a los sitios y aplicaciones web.

2. ¿Cómo puedo acceder a la dirección IP del usuario en JavaScript?

Puedes acceder a la dirección IP del usuario utilizando la API Geolocation de HTML5 y el método getCurrentPosition. Este método devuelve la posición actual del usuario, que incluye información sobre la ubicación geográfica, incluida la dirección IP.

3. ¿Existen limitaciones al mostrar la dirección IP con JavaScript?

Sí, existen algunas limitaciones al mostrar la dirección IP con JavaScript. Por ejemplo, la API Geolocation puede requerir el consentimiento del usuario para acceder a la ubicación geográfica, y algunos navegadores pueden bloquear este acceso por defecto. Además, ten en cuenta que la dirección IP obtenida puede no ser 100% precisa.

4. ¿Cuáles son las alternativas a JavaScript para mostrar la dirección IP?

Si prefieres no utilizar JavaScript o necesitas una solución más precisa, puedes utilizar servicios de terceros que proporcionan la dirección IP del usuario a través de una API. Algunos ejemplos populares incluyen ipify, ipapi y ipstack.

Si quieres conocer otros artículos parecidos a Cómo mostrar tu dirección IP usando JavaScript: Guía paso a paso puedes visitar la categoría Javascript.

Leonel Jiménez

Apasionado de la programación. Trabajando en este rubro de la programación desde hace 11 años. Ahora compartiendo contenido de programación esperando aportar valor a otros programadores. No olvides visitar mi canal de youtube

Deja una respuesta

Subir

Para ofrecer las mejores experiencias, utilizamos tecnologías como las cookies para almacenar y/o acceder a la información del dispositivo. El consentimiento de estas tecnologías nos permitirá procesar datos como el comportamiento de navegación o las identificaciones únicas en este sitio. No consentir o retirar el consentimiento, puede afectar negativamente a ciertas características y funciones. Más Información